Range of sizes, shapes, and styles

Small decorative wall mirrors come in a wide range of sizes, shapes, and styles, catering to diverse tastes and interior design preferences. This versatility allows them to seamlessly blend into any room’s decor, whether it’s a traditional, modern, rustic, or contemporary space.

  • Size:

    Small decorative wall mirrors typically range in size from a few inches to a few feet, making them suitable for various locations and purposes. Smaller mirrors are ideal for creating accent pieces or adding a touch of sparkle to a small space, while larger mirrors can serve as statement pieces or be used to create the illusion of a bigger room.

  • Shape:

    The shape of a small decorative wall mirror can significantly impact its overall look and feel. Common shapes include round, square, rectangular, oval, and irregular forms. Round mirrors are often used to add a touch of softness and femininity to a space, while square and rectangular mirrors exude a more modern and minimalist aesthetic. Oval and irregular-shaped mirrors can add a unique and eye-catching element to a room.

  • Style:

    Small decorative wall mirrors are available in a plethora of styles, from classic and traditional to modern and contemporary. Framed mirrors are a popular choice, with frames made from various materials such as wood, metal, plastic, or even embellished with intricate carvings or patterns. Frameless mirrors offer a sleek and minimalist look, allowing the reflective surface to take center stage. Some mirrors may also incorporate additional features like beveled edges, tinted glass, or etched designs.

  • Finish:

    The finish of a small decorative wall mirror can further enhance its overall appearance. Mirrors with a polished or shiny finish reflect light more effectively, creating a brighter and more spacious feel. Alternatively, mirrors with a matte or distressed finish can add a touch of rustic charm or vintage elegance to a space.

The extensive range of sizes, shapes, styles, and finishes available for small decorative wall mirrors ensures that there is an option to complement any design scheme and personal preference. Whether seeking to add a subtle accent or create a bold focal point, these mirrors offer endless possibilities for transforming a room’s ambiance.

Choose reflective properties wisely

The reflective properties of a small decorative wall mirror play a crucial role in determining its functionality and overall impact on the space. Here are some key considerations to keep in mind when selecting the reflective properties of a small decorative wall mirror:

1. Standard Mirrors:
Standard mirrors provide clear and accurate reflections, making them suitable for functional purposes such as personal grooming, makeup application, and checking one’s appearance. They offer a true-to-life representation of the reflected image and are commonly found in bathrooms, bedrooms, and dressing areas.

2. Tinted Mirrors:
Tinted mirrors feature a colored or reflective coating that alters the appearance of the reflected image. They can add a touch of color and visual interest to a space while still maintaining their reflective functionality. Tinted mirrors are often used in decorative applications, such as creating accent walls or adding a unique touch to a room’s decor.

3. Antiqued Mirrors:
Antiqued mirrors undergo a special treatment to give them an aged or distressed appearance. They often have a mottled or spotted surface that creates a sense of history and vintage charm. Antiqued mirrors are popular in rustic, vintage, or eclectic decor styles and can add a touch of character to a space.

4. One-Way Mirrors:
One-way mirrors, also known as two-way mirrors, are coated with a special film that allows people on one side of the mirror to see through it while reflecting the image of those on the other side. These mirrors are commonly used in security and surveillance applications, as well as in specialized settings like interrogation rooms.

When choosing the reflective properties of a small decorative wall mirror, consider the intended purpose of the mirror, the overall style and decor of the space, and the desired visual effect. Standard mirrors offer clear and functional reflections, while tinted, antiqued, and one-way mirrors provide unique aesthetic and functional qualities.

Hang securely and maintain properly

To ensure the safety and longevity of your small decorative wall mirror, it is crucial to hang it securely and maintain it properly. Here are some key points to consider:

  • Choose the right hanging hardware:

    Select appropriate hanging hardware that can support the weight of the mirror. Consider the size, weight, and frame material of the mirror when choosing screws, nails, or other hanging mechanisms. It is always better to opt for heavier-duty hardware to ensure a secure installation.

  • Find suitable wall studs:

    Locate the wall studs behind the desired hanging location using a stud finder. Studs provide a solid and secure base for hanging the mirror, ensuring it remains stable and prevents damage to the wall.

  • Hang the mirror level:

    Use a level to ensure the mirror is hung straight and level. A crooked mirror can appear visually unappealing and may also pose a safety hazard. Use a spirit level or a laser level to achieve precise alignment.

  • Clean the mirror regularly:

    To maintain the mirror’s reflective surface and overall appearance, clean it regularly with a soft, lint-free cloth and a mild glass cleaner. Avoid using abrasive materials or harsh chemicals, as these can damage the mirror’s surface.

By following these guidelines for hanging and maintaining your small decorative wall mirror, you can ensure its safety, longevity, and continued beauty in your space.
